Pennsylvania Has Most COVID-19 Cases Among Meat Processing Workers

At least 858 workers from 22 meat processing plants in Pennsylvania contracted COVID-19. That number is the highest among 19 states that reported to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.

According to the data released last week, the state has seen at least 858 cases from 22 meet-processing plants. That figure is the highest among 19 states reported to the CDC and includes Enock Benjamin, a former worker at the JBS Souderton plant whose family filed a wrongful death lawsuit against the company after his death.

Delaware ranked seventh with 336 cases from six poultry processing plants.
